+# This is a distribution configuration file template.
+# This configuration file is meant to run specific actions
+# depending on the Linux version the VE is running.
+#
+# After an action is initiated, it requests vzctl to read the configuration on the basis
+# of the DISTRIBUTION or (if not present) on the OSTEMPLATE variable in the VE
+# configuration file. In case an unknown distribution version has been found,
+# the default configuration file is used for this distribution.
+# If no configuration file was found, the default.conf file is used.
+#
+
+# This script is launched inside a VE on executing the following commands:
+#	vzctl start VEID
+#	vzctl set VEID --ipadd <ip>
+#
+# The script is used to configure the network settings
+# on the VE startup or on the IP address(es) assignment.
+# The parameters are passed to the corresponding environment variables.
+# Required parameters:
+#   IP_ADDR	- the IP address(es) to be added to the VE
+#                 (the space is used to separate several IP addresses)
+# Optional parameters:
+#   VE_STATE	- the state of the VE; can be either "starting" or "running"
+#   IPDELALL	- deletes all old interfaces
+#
+ADD_IP=pld-add_ip.sh
+
+# This script is launched inside a VE on executing the following commands:
+#	vzctl set VEID --ipdel <ip>
+#	vzctl set VEID --ipdel <all>
+#
+# The script is used to delete an existing IP address(es).
+# The parameters are passed to the corresponding environment variables.
+# Required parameters:
+#   IP_ADDR	- the IP addresses to be deleted from the VE
+#		(the space is used to separate several IP addresses)
+# Optional parameters:
+#   IPDELALL	- deletes all existing IP addresses
+#
+DEL_IP=pld-del_ip.sh
+
+# This script is launched inside a VE on executing the following command:
+#	vzctl set VEID --hostname <name>
+#
+# The script is used to configure the hostname of the VE.
+# The parameters are passed to the corresponding environment variables.
+# Required parameters:
+#   HOSTNM	- the hostname of the VE
+#
+SET_HOSTNAME=pld-set_hostname.sh
+
+# This script is launched inside a VE on executing the following command:
+#	vzctl set VEID --searchdomain <domain> --nameserver <ip>
+#
+# The script is used to configure DNS parameters in the /etc/resolv.conf file.
+# The parameters are passed to the corresponding environment variables.
+# Optional parameters:
+#   SEARCHDOMAIN- Sets a search domain(s) for the VE. Modifies the /etc/resolv.conf file.
+#   NAMESERVER	- Sets a name server(s) for the VE. Modifies the /etc/resolv.conf file.
+#
+SET_DNS=set_dns.sh
+
+# This script is launched inside a VE on executing the following command:
+#	vzctl set VEID --userpasswd <user:passwd>
+#
+# The script is used to add a new user or change the current password.
+# The parameters are passed to the corresponding environment variables.
+# Required parameters:
+#   USERPW  - Sets a new password for the VE user. If the user does not exist,
+# 		the script creates a new user with the specified password.
+#
+SET_USERPASS=set_userpass.sh
+
+# This script is launched inside a VE on executing the following command:
+#	vzctl set VEID --quotaugidlimit <num>
+#
+# The script is used to set up second level quota.
+# The parameters are passed to the corresponding environment variables.
+# Required parameters:
+#   MINOR	- the root device minor number
+#   MAJOR	- the root device major number
+SET_UGID_QUOTA=set_ugid_quota.sh
+
+# This script is launched on the Hardware Node after the VE creation:
+#	vzctl create VEID
+#
+# The script is used to perform certain postcreate tasks.
+# The parameters are passed to the corresponding environment variables.
+# Required parameters:
+#   VE_ROOT	- the root path of the VE
+POST_CREATE=postcreate.sh
